Quality Inn San Antonio Fiesta at Six Flags is a lodging, located at 6755 North Loop 1604 W, San Antonio, TX 78249, USA. They can be contacted via phone at +1 210-696-4766, visit their website www.choicehotels.com for more detailed information.
